Job Description

Join our elite team of healthcare professionals for rewarding weekend night shifts in San Antonio! We offer flexible Saturday/Sunday schedules with competitive pay and comprehensive benefits. As a leader in patient-centered care, we're seeking dedicated individuals to join our dynamic 12-hour night shifts (7:00 PM - 7:00 AM). Enjoy work-life balance with no weekday obligations while making a meaningful impact in our community.

Responsibilities

  • Provide exceptional patient care during weekend night shifts
  • Monitor vital signs and administer medications accurately
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ary care teams
  • Document patient records with precision and timeliness
  • Respond to emergency situations following protocols
  • Maintain sterile environments and infection control standards
  • Support patient education and family communication

Qualifications

  • Current RN or LVN license in Texas
  • Minimum 1 year acute care experience
  • BLS/CPR certification required
  • Strong critical thinking and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work independently during night shifts
  • Excellent communication and documentation abilities
  • Flexibility to adapt to changing patient needs
